Putin discussed the fight against coronavirus with Berdymukhamedov

26 April 2021

 

The Kremlin press service said that Russian President Vladimir Putin discussed with Turkmen President Gurbanguly Berdymukhamedov the joint fight against the coronavirus infection.

 

‘A telephone conversation took place between Russian President Vladimir Putin and Turkmen President Gurbanguly Berdymukhamedov. It was highlighted that the strategic partnership between Russia and Turkmenistan was developing successfully. In this regard, some topical issues of bilateral cooperation were discussed with a focus on the further consolidation of mutually beneficial trade and economic ties and joint fight against the coronavirus infection’, the report says. 

 

In addition to it, the leaders touched upon preparations for the VI Caspian Summit and II Caspian Economic Forum scheduled for this year.

 

‘Vladimir Putin also expressed his deepest condolences over the recent death of Turkmen President’s father’, the report says. It was reported on 18 April that the father of the President of Turkmenistan, Myalikguly Berdymukhamedov, passed away at the age of 89.
